[OpenSER-Users-ES] Sobre msg:len y max_forwards

Iñaki Baz Castillo ibc at aliax.net
Sat Sep 1 13:17:26 CEST 2007


Hola, ayer reporté un bug en OpenWengo ya que si lo registras contra una 
cuenta SIP (distinta de Wengo) resulta que en el REGISTER mete un 
completamente fuera de lugar "Route":

  http://dev.openwengo.com/trac/openwengo/trac.cgi/ticket/1793

El caso es que eso provoca que OpenSer se reenvíe el mensaje así mismo 
infinitamente hasta que se cumpla msg:len ó max_forwards, entonces es 
desechado.

Pero claro, con la tontería ya hemos tenido unas cuantas decenas de mensajes 
procesadosa toda velocidad. No sé hasta qué punto puede ser esto cargante 
para la CPU y OpenSer, pero cualquiera desde cualquier parte del mundo puede 
poner un SipP que envíe este REGISTER "malicioso" infinitamente.

¿Cómo luchar contra estas cosas? o mejor dicho ¿hay que tratar de evitarlas? 
¿tal vez con un módulo creo que nuevo que vi el otro día anunciado en la 
lista en inglés y que no recuerdo?

-- 
Iñaki Baz Castillo




More information about the Users-es mailing list